FL S1610
Bill
AI Summary
- Creates a uniform, statewide identification badge for noninstructional contractors with a photograph that must be worn and visible while on school grounds.
- Requires contractors to be U.S. residents/citizens or permanent resident aliens, at least 18 years old, and meet background screening requirements to receive an identification badge.
- Designates the badge as valid for 5 years and recognized by all school districts; contractors must return the badge within 48 hours if they notify the district of changes under existing requirements.
- Authorizes the Department of Education to establish a uniform cost for the badge to be charged to and paid by the contractor.
- Exempts noninstructional contractors who are exempt from background screening requirements under Florida Statutes section 1012.468 from the identification badge requirement.
